Trade Investigation Initiated Over China Deal Compliance

The Trump administration is preparing to file a trade investigation into China’s implementation of the 2020 trade agreement, according to reports from Washington. Sources familiar with the matter indicate this move could potentially lead to additional tariffs on Chinese imports and further escalate tensions between the world’s two largest economies.

Federal Investment Sparks Lithium Stock Surge

Lithium Americas Corp. has experienced a dramatic stock price increase of 129.5% over the past month, according to reports, following significant federal government investment in the company. Sources indicate the U.S. federal government took a stake in the lithium producer, fueling investor enthusiasm for the strategically important sector.
